SAFETY INFORMATION
FIRE OR EXPLOSION MAY OCCUR! Heater has hot arcing or
sparking parts inside. Do not use it in areas where gasoline, paint
or flammable liquids are used or stored.
RISK OF FIRE. To prevent a possible fire, Do not block intakes or
exhaust in any manner. Do not use on soft surfaces, like a bed where
openings may become blocked. Heater must be kept clear of all
obstructions. Maintain a 3 foot minimum clearance from front and 12 inches from sides and rear.
Heaters must be kept clean of lint, dirt, and debris (see maintenance instructions Page 10).
RISK OF FIRE. DO NOT use heater with extension cord. Plug the
MH-425A-240 heater directly into a 208-240VAC receptacle. For
alternating current only.
BURN HAZARD. This heater is hot when in use. To avoid burns,
do not let bare skin touch hot surfaces. If provided, use handles
when moving the heater. Allow the heater to cool down before
touching it.
RISK OF ELECTRIC SHOCK OR INJURY. Do not run cord under
carpeting, Do not cover cord with throw rugs, runners or similar
coverings. Do not route cord under furniture or appliances. Arrange
cord away form the traffic area where it will not cause a tripping hazard. Do not operate any
heater with a damaged cord or plug, or after heater malfunctions, or has been dropped or
damaged in any manner. Disconnect power at service panel. Discard heater, or return to
authorized service facility for examination and / or repair.

RISK OF ELECTRICAL SHOCK. Connect to properly
grounded outlets only. Do not insert or allow foreign
objects to enter any ventilation or exhaust opening as
this may cause an electric shock or fire, or damage the heater. Unplug heater
before performing any maintenance or when not in use, to disconnect heater,
turn control to low, then remove plug from outlet.

Extreme caution is necessary when any heater is
used by or near children or invalids whenever the
heater is left operating and unattended.
Do not use outdoors. Not for commercial/industrial
use.
This heater is not intended for use in bathrooms,
laundry areas and similar indoor locations. Never
locate heater where it may fall into a bathtub or
other water container.
Do not use heater in wet or moist locations.
Always locate heater on a stable and level surface.
Do not place the heater against paperboard or low-
density berboard surfaces.
Avoid using an extension cord because the
extension cord may overheat and cause a risk of
re.
ALWAYS use only the electrical power (voltage
and frequency) specified on the model plate of the
heater.
ALWAYS use only three-prong, grounded outlet
and extension cord.
ALWAYS unplug the heater when not in use.
To disconnect heater, turn controls to off, and turn
off power to heater circuit at main disconnect panel
or unplug from the power outlet.
ALWAYS install the heater so that it is not directly
exposed to water spray, rain, dripping water, or
wind.
Keep all combustible materials away from this
heater
